Values.ResolverQueryLogConfigAssociationSourceIn the response to an AssociateResolverQueryLogConfig, DisassociateResolverQueryLogConfig, GetResolverQueryLogConfigAssociation, or ListResolverQueryLogConfigAssociations, request, a complex type that contains settings for a specified association between an Amazon VPC and a query logging configuration.
type nonrec t = {id : ResourceId.t option;The ID of the query logging association.
*)resolverQueryLogConfigId : ResourceId.t option;The ID of the query logging configuration that a VPC is associated with.
*)resourceId : ResourceId.t option;The ID of the Amazon VPC that is associated with the query logging configuration.
*)status : ResolverQueryLogConfigAssociationStatus.t option;The status of the specified query logging association. Valid values include the following: CREATING: Resolver is creating an association between an Amazon VPC and a query logging configuration. ACTIVE: The association between an Amazon VPC and a query logging configuration was successfully created. Resolver is logging queries that originate in the specified VPC. DELETING: Resolver is deleting this query logging association. FAILED: Resolver either couldn't create or couldn't delete the query logging association.
*)error : ResolverQueryLogConfigAssociationError.t option;If the value of Status is FAILED, the value of Error indicates the cause: DESTINATION_NOT_FOUND: The specified destination (for example, an Amazon S3 bucket) was deleted. ACCESS_DENIED: Permissions don't allow sending logs to the destination. If the value of Status is a value other than FAILED, Error is null.
*)errorMessage : ResolverQueryLogConfigAssociationErrorMessage.t option;Contains additional information about the error. If the value or Error is null, the value of ErrorMessage also is null.
*)creationTime : Rfc3339TimeString.t option;The date and time that the VPC was associated with the query logging configuration, in Unix time format and Coordinated Universal Time (UTC).
*)}val to_value :
t ->
[> `Structure of
(string * [> `Enum of string | `String of ResourceId.t ]) list ]